Luing

Luing is a village located in Gangtok subdivision of East District district in Sikkim, India. It is situated 8km away from Gangtok, which is both district & sub-district headquarter of Luing village. As per 2009 stats, Luing Parbing is the gram panchayat of Luing village.

About Luing

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Luing is 261305. The village spans a total geographical area of 416.42 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 737101. Gangtok is nearest town to Luing village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 8km away.

When it comes to local governance, Luing village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Upper burtuk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Sikkim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Luing

According to the 2011 Census, Luing has a total population of about 2,019, with approximately 1,037 males and 982 females. The sex ratio is around 946 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 219 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. There are about 41 members of the Scheduled Castes (SC), an important community in the village. The Scheduled Tribes (ST) population numbers around 243. The overall literacy rate is approximately 74.10%, with male literacy at about 78.69% and female literacy near 69.25%. There are around 413 households in the village. Connectivity of Luing

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Luing. As per the 2011 stats, Luing had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.
